Violet Agnes (Dolly) Smith

Posted

VETERAN – Violet Agnes (Dolly) Smith, 84, of Veteran, formerly of Lewistown, Mont., passed away Sunday morning, Dec. 29, 2019, at her home after a lengthy battle with cancer. 

She was born March 5, 1935, in Jordan, Mont., the daughter of Earl and Alice (Bauman) Adams. She received her education in Roy, Mont., graduating from Roy High School in 1953. She then attended Northern Montana College in Havre and received her degree in elementary education. She taught grade school at Hilger and Suffolk, Mont.

On July 8, 1957, she was united in marriage to Vernon Smith in Sheridan. They lived and ranched near Winifred, where they raised their three children. When she stopped teaching, she began as a cow/calf producer and raised Registered Quarter Horses on her ranches in Montana and Nebraska until she retired and moved to Veteran.

She was supportive and encouraged her children throughout their Rodeo events in calf roping and ladies barrel racing.

Dolly is survived by daughters Joan, of Veteran, and Jacqueline, of Melstone, Mont.; son Vaughn of Veteran; grandsons: Jason (Aimee) Rich, Dillon (Alexandria) Rich; and seven great-grandchildren: Shamus, Adeline, Thera, Oskar, Paislee, Cash and Joplyn Rich, all of Billings, Mont.

She was preceded in death by her husband, brother Monte Lund and parents.

Graveside Services for Dolly Smith were 2 p.m. Saturday, Jan. 4, 2020, in the Lewistown City Cemetery. Reception followed at the Eagles Club. The Cloyd Funeral Home assisted the family.
